After 45 years of smoking it has now been 99 days smoke free. Wifey still smokes but not in front of me. No more coughing for me. I am a little out of breath sometimes for some reason after climbing stairs, I am sure it will go away after a while. Feeling a little bit fat. Not surprised how ever because the first week of not smoking all I wanted was pineapple donuts. Could not get enough of pineapple donuts. And maybe the odd chocolate covered one as well with jam inside. Didn't crave anything else except pineapple donuts. This craving has now gone. Need to walk in morning but a bit cold. Rather be a little chubby wubby than a smoker. The smell of smoke does not bother me nor does it make me want the odd puff.At least half time at the MCG,I am not one of those anymore rushing to have the 3 cigaros before the game starts again. However there is a donut van near the smokers area...........mmmmmmm

Hey Tony, when i quit just short of a year back i too was a cake junkie. Not donuts but beautiful baked cheesecake and an exotic sweet called canoli. I too added a few pounds but have now come back to my original weight from when i quit smoking. It is ok for first say 6 mths to eat sweets and whatever you desire to kill the cravings but then you need to take hold and eat cakes in moderation and doing away with all form of sugar to start to control your weight. Walking half hr a day also helps immensely. I smoked for 52 yrs before calling it quits and it is now that cravings barely exist. Some habit still about but manageable. Good luck and yes we can quit if we really try.
